The concerns for giving up a 1st and the necessary contract to sign Butler are legitimate. However, the opportunity outweighs the risk, IMO. I would feel extremely uneasy going into the season with the same group of CBs from last year, plus a rookie or two. Our top 3 CBs (Breaux, Williams, Swann), have missed a combined 65 out of 96 games the last two seasons. The need for a quality CB is there, and we have the opportunity and resources to fill it.
